Overview
Nina Kaczrowski supports the labor and employment team, providing efficiency and effectiveness throughout the entire litigation process. Nina plays a key role in exceeding the client’s expectations by performing detailed, analytical work while managing the needs of the team.
Nina’s experience includes large document collection, document review and production, deposition preparation, preparation for and assistance at mediation and arbitrations, and electronic presentation of evidence at trials. Her substantial knowledge of labor and employment law includes collective class actions, AAA arbitrations, and other individual and corporate disputes involving state and federal law.
